Commit Message

Eugenio Perez Martin Jan. 12, 2023, 5:24 p.m. UTC
To restore the device at the destination of a live migration we send the
commands through control virtqueue. For a device to read CVQ it must
have received the DRIVER_OK status bit.

However this opens a window where the device could start receiving
packets in rx queue 0 before it receives the RSS configuration. To avoid
that, we will not send vring_enable until all configuration is used by
the device.

As a first step, run vhost_set_vring_ready for all vhost_net backend after
all of them are started (with DRIVER_OK). This code should not affect
vdpa.

If I understand the code correctly:

For CVQ, we do SET_VRING_ENABLE before DRIVER_OK, that's fine.

For datapath_vq, we do SET_VRING_ENABLE after DRIVER_OK, this requires 
parent driver support (explained above)


>
> Some parent drivers do not support sending the queue enable command
> after DRIVER_OK, usually because they clean part of the state like the
> set by set_vring_base. Even vdpa_net_sim needs fixes here.


Yes, so the question is:

Do we need another backend feature for this? (otherwise thing may break 
silently)


>
> But my understanding is that it should be supported so I consider it a
> bug.


Probably, we need fine some proof in the spec, e.g in 3.1.1:

"""

7.Perform device-specific setup, including discovery of virtqueues for 
the device, optional per-bus setup, reading and possibly writing the 
device’s virtio configuration space, and population of virtqueues.
8.Set the DRIVER_OK status bit. At this point the device is “live”.

"""

So if my understanding is correct, "discovery of virtqueues for the 
device" implies queue_enable here which is expected to be done before 
DRIVER_OK. But it doesn't say anything regrading to the behaviour of 
setting queue ready after DRIVER_OK.

I'm not sure it's a real bug or not, may Michael and comment on this.


>   Especially after queue_reset patches. Is that what you mean?


We haven't supported queue_reset yet in Qemu. But it allows to write 1 
to queue_enable after DRIVER_OK for sure.

Note that the only user of vhost_set_vring_enable() is vhost-user where 
the semantic is different:

It uses that to changes the number of active queues:

static int peer_attach(VirtIONet *n, int index)

         if (nc->peer->info->type == NET_CLIENT_DRIVER_VHOST_USER) {
=>      vhost_set_vring_enable(nc->peer, 1);
     }

This is not the semantic of vhost-vDPA that tries to be complaint with 
virtio-spec. So I'm not sure how it can help here.


>
> And we want to explicitly enable CVQ first, which "only" vhost_net
> knows which is.


This should be known by net/vhost-vdpa.c.

You can use DPDK's testpmd [0] tool with Vhost PMD, e.g.:

#single queue pair
# dpdk-testpmd -l <CORE IDs> --no-pci 
--vdev=net_vhost0,iface=/tmp/vhost-user1 -- -i

#multiqueue
# dpdk-testpmd -l <CORE IDs> --no-pci 
--vdev=net_vhost0,iface=/tmp/vhost-user1,queues=4 -- -i --rxq=4 --txq=4
